Then came a “1-2 punch,” as Rzeznik calls it, that crushed his world. In February 1981, when John was 15, Joseph Rzeznik had a heart attack, then caught pneumonia in the hospital, and died.Why did George Tutuska leave Goo Goo Dolls?
Departure. Prior to Tutuska’s departure from the Goo Goo Dolls, there was a payment dispute between him and long-time friend and singer/guitarist John Rzeznik over Tutuska’s contribution to the writing of the Superstar Car Wash single “Fallin’ Down”.
What was the original band name of the Goo Goo Dolls?The Goo Goo Dolls were formed in Buffalo, NY, in 1985 by guitarist/vocalist Johnny Rzeznik, bassist Robby Takac, and drummer George Tutuska, initially under the name the Sex Maggots. Originally a cover band with a taste for power pop and classic rock & roll, the group soon began writing its own songs.

What was the Goo Goo Dolls first hit?
1995: “A Boy Named Goo” is released, and reveals a much more polished blend of pop, punk and garage rock. “Long Way Down,” a spirited rocker, makes it to No. 25 on the Billboard Hot 100. The acoustic-based “Name” becomes the band’s first major hit, making it to No.

Who influenced the Goo Goo Dolls?
Takac and Rzeznik decided on the name Goo Goo Dolls when they spotted an ad for a doll with a moveable, rubber head in True Detective magazine. Early musical influences for the band include the Sex Pistols, the Damned, Devo, the Plasmatics and other punk rock pioneers of the late 1970s and early 1980s.
